I remember when my preschool kids would do this - we are talking about water going down the drain so there must be a faucet. CA is notoriously bad at capturing runoff water. They do tend to lose a lot of water into the ocean. They have to divert water from the cities to avoid flooding. They use too many non-porous materials to divert water so none of it seeps back into the ground, and they don’t have enough reservoirs because some land is too expensive. They would need to adjust their facilities to process water tainted by urban contamination. It is a whole thing. It wouldn’t be easy - nor cheap. But the concept that CA is dumping too much water into the ocean is sound. It is every single thing he said after that statement that is utterly uninformed and ridiculous. One reason why trump may need a hug is because the J6 gala, insupported for all those arrested and in jail, set at one of trump's New Jersey owned country clubs had to indefinitely postpone the event. No future date announced. And one of the possible reasons it might have been postposed is because in the state of New Jersey, liquor licenses cannot be issued to convicted felons. And it appears that right now no liquor is being served at trump's NJ golf courses. Although trump was allegedly issued a temporary license, no update has been issued since the scheduled hearing on July 19 in Trenton and the temporary liceense may have been revoked.
